| Q. |
My family and I just moved from Norway, and we’re trying to find a church. Every Sunday we go to a different church. I feel like I don’t want to go anymore. Could you please tell me what to do?
Tresa, 10 Kansas |
| A. | Wow, you’re certainly dealing with a lot of changes. Your feelings of frustration are understandable. But during stressful times, it’s a good idea not to give up doing things that are important to you. And from your letter, it’s obvious that your relationship with God and attending church are priorities in your life. God thinks they’re important, too. Paul once said: "I want them to be strengthened and joined together with love so that they may be rich in their understanding. This leads to their knowing fully God’s secret, that is, Christ himself" (Colossians 2:2, NCV). As you can see, joining other Christians to worship God every week is vital. Don’t give up! |
